Marilyn E. Strutchens (she/her) is an Emily R. and Gerald S. Leischuck Endowed Professor and Mildred Cheshire Fraley Distinguished Professor of mathematics education at Auburn University. She currently serves as Chair of the Advisory Committee for NSF’s Directorate for STEM Education. Her research focuses on equity issues in mathematics education, clinical experiences for secondary teacher candidates, professional development for mathematics teachers, and growth and development of teacher leaders in mathematics education.
